BaPSe₄ is a barium phosphoselenide ceramic compound combining barium, phosphorus, and selenium into a dense, crystalline structure. This material is primarily of research and academic interest rather than established in high-volume industrial production, with potential applications in optoelectronic devices, infrared optics, and solid-state chemistry where mixed-anion ceramics offer tunable electronic and photonic properties. Engineers would consider this material for specialized applications requiring wide bandgap semiconductors or optical components in the infrared region, though technical maturity and commercial availability remain limited compared to conventional ceramic or III-V semiconductor alternatives.
